The MeCP1 complex represses transcription through preferential binding, remodeling, and deacetylating methylated nucleosomes
Histone deacetylation plays an important role in methylated DNA silencing. Recent studies indicated that the methyl-CpG-binding protein, MBD2, is a component of the MeCP1 histone deacetylase complex.
